Exponential functions can be integrated using the following formulas. ∫ exdx = ex+C ∫ axdx = ax lna +C ∫ e x d x = e x + C ∫ a x d x = a x ln a + C. The nature of the antiderivative of ex e x makes it fairly easy to identify what to choose as u u. If only one e e exists, choose the exponent of e e as u u.

WebFeb 23, 2024 · The integrand contains an Algebraic term (x) and an \textbf {E}xponential term (ex). Our mnemonic suggests letting u be the algebraic term, so we choose u = x and dv = exdx. Then du = dx and v = ex as indicated by the tables below. Figure 2.1.2: Setting up Integration by Parts. provincetown ma breweryWebThough they don't look it, the two answers are equivalent.
